Montelukast Description
Overview of Montelukast
Montelukast is a medication widely used for managing respiratory conditions such as asthma and allergic rhinitis. It belongs to the class of drugs known as leukotriene receptor antagonists. The primary function of Montelukast is to block the action of leukotrienes, which are chemicals in the body responsible for inflammation, airway constriction, and mucus production. By doing so, the medication helps to reduce symptoms and improve breathing in patients suffering from respiratory issues.
How It Works
The active ingredient in Montelukast works by targeting specific receptors in the lungs and airways. When leukotrienes are released, they cause swelling, muscle tightening, and mucus build-up, all of which contribute to asthma attacks or allergy symptoms. Montelukast binds to these receptors, preventing leukotrienes from attaching and exerting their effects. This mechanism results in decreased airway inflammation, less bronchospasm, and reduced mucus secretion. The effectiveness of Montelukast as a preventive medication makes it suitable for long-term management of respiratory symptoms.
Application and Usage
Montelukast is typically prescribed as a once-daily oral tablet, taken in the evening or as directed by a healthcare professional. It is important to adhere to the prescribed dosage to maintain optimal control over symptoms. Patients are advised to continue using Montelukast regularly, even if they start feeling better, as it is primarily a preventive medication. It is not intended for relief of immediate asthma attacks, which require fast-acting inhalers. Consultation with a healthcare provider is necessary to determine the appropriate dosage and to monitor treatment progress.
Effectiveness and Benefits
Many patients find Montelukast to be effective in reducing the frequency and severity of asthma attacks. It can also significantly improve symptoms of allergic rhinitis such as sneezing, runny nose, and nasal congestion. The medication’s oral form makes it convenient for daily use, especially for children who may have difficulty using inhalers. Furthermore, Montelukast has a favorable safety profile, with usually mild side effects reported. Its role in combination therapy can enhance overall respiratory health and prevent exacerbations of chronic conditions.
Side Effects and Precautions
While generally well-tolerated, Montelukast can cause side effects in some individuals. Common reactions include headache, stomach pain, and fatigue. Rarely, more serious adverse effects such as mood changes, agitation, hallucinations, or allergic reactions may occur. Patients should be vigilant about any unusual behavioral or psychological symptoms when using this medication. It is important to inform your healthcare provider about any pre-existing conditions, especially psychiatric disorders, prior to starting Montelukast. Regular monitoring and communication with a doctor can help minimize potential risks.
